Quantizing
Quantizingisamethodofadjustingthetiming
ofnotesrecordedintoasequence.Itcanbeused
toadjustnotetiminginordertofixmistakesinaperformance,ortomakenotesadheretoa
stricttiminggridasastylisticchoice(asinmuchmodernelectronicmusic.)Quantizednotes
havetechnicallyperfecttimingbuttendto
soundlesslikeahumanperformance.Quantization
canbeappliedautomaticallytoeachtrackasitisrecorded,oritcanbeappliedafterrecordingto
onlyspecificselections.FordetailsseetheQuantparameteronpage 12‐17intheSongMode:The
MISCPagesection,andtheQuantizefunction
onpage 12‐27intheSongEditor:TrackFunctions
section.
Creating Loops With The Big Time Page
OntheBigTimepageyoucansetthesequencertoloopaselectionofbars.SettheLoop
parametertoLoop,andsetatimefortheTimeInandTimeOutparameters.Now,pressing
Play/Pauseonthefront
panelwillcauseyourselectiontoplayrepeatedlyandseamlessly.You
willmostcommonlywanttosetyourTimeInandTimeOutpointstoequalanevennumberof
barssuchas2,4,8,etc.Recordingintoaloopedsectionofbarsisacommontechniquefor
recording
sequencebasedmusic.Forexample,withadrumprogramselectedforatrack,you
couldrecordadrumpartbyplayingonedrumsoundeachtimethrougha2barloop,untilthe
entire2bardrum“beat”soundscomplete.
Next,youcouldsettheRecModeparametertoUnloop.(Touse
theUnLoopsetting,theLoop
parametermustbesettoLoop,andalooplengthmustbesetwiththeTimeInandTimeOutparameters
ontheBIGpage.)WiththeRecModeparametersettoUnloop,anyexistingtrackswillbeplayed
backasiftheywerelooping
fromtheTimeIntotheTimeOutpoint,buttheyareactuallybeing
re‐recordedlinearlyoverabsoluteBarsandBeatsuntilyoupressStop.UnLoopallowsyouto
recordalineartrackoverashortloopingsectionwithoutfirsthavingtocopythesectionover
andoveragainto
achieveanewdesiredSonglength.TheEndpointoftheSongisextendedto
thedownbeatofthe(empty)BarimmediatelyfollowingthelastBaryouwererecordingwhen
Stopwaspressed.SeeRecMode on page 12‐11fordetails.
